Apr 15 — Mark 15:40-47

Posted on April 15, 2007November 8, 2023 by Norm

SCRIPTURE: Mark 15:40-47 OBSERVATION: Jesus identified with society’s second class citizens – women, children, tax collectors, prostitutes, Samaritans – and they identified with Him, here we see the women who followed Jesus. ”Joseph of Arimathea, a prominent member of the Council”, shows the remarkable impact that Jesus had, not just for society’s outcasts. Joseph was a…

Apr 14 — Mark 15:21-39

Posted on April 14, 2007November 8, 2023 by Norm

SCRIPTURE: Mark 15:21-39 OBSERVATION: That Mark mentions Alexander and Rufus suggests that he knew of them, possibly that they became Christ followers. ”Wine mixed with myrrh” was like a pain killer, this is why Jesus declined it. ”Cast lots”, probably a joke, was there much left of the clothes after his trial? Those who mocked Jesus…
